Riluzole treatment paradoxically increases motoneuron excitability in ALS due to hyperactive homeostasis

<h4>ABSTRACT</h4> Riluzole is the most commonly prescribed among the limited approved therapies for amyotrophic lateral sclerosis (ALS), a neurodegenerative disorder characterized by progressive motoneuron loss and paralysis.
